Sony Japan has patented a new VR controller, in the process fuelling talk of future PlayStation hardware. The patent was filed earlier this year, but it only came to light more recently (via a report on Gearnuke).
It's got a catchy working title too, with the patent called "CONTROLLER HAVING LIGHTS DISPOSTED ALONG A LOOP OF THE CONTROLLER". Hopefully, the marketing team can come up with something better should this ever see the light of day...
It's not dissimilar to another prototype that we reported on at the very start of the year, and thus it seems that Sony is intent on upgrading the Move controllers that weren't even designed primarily with VR mind.
